Thanks for contributing. This guide covers how we branch, commit, and review so the history stays clean and the work stays legible.
Trunk-based with short-lived branches. main is protected β no direct pushes.
Branch β keep it small β open a PR β get it reviewed β squash-merge β delete
the branch.
type/scope-desc, e.g. feat/api-predict-endpoint, feat/ui-taste-meters,
chore/infra-compose.
Conventional Commits, scope = module:
feat(api): add /predict endpoint backed by ONNX Runtime
fix(training): correct InChIKey dedup collision
docs(data): document ChemTastesDB column names
- Types:
feat fix docs chore refactor test perf - Scopes:
training aroma api serving ui infra data docs - Commits must be signed (GPG or SSH). PRs with unsigned commits won't merge.
- Commits must also be signed off (
git commit -s) β theSigned-off-by:line certifies the DCO and your agreement to the project's Contributor License Agreement, which lets Flavormancer be offered both open-source and as proprietary on-premise builds. SeeCLA.md.
- Small β one logical change, readable as a sequence of decisions.
- Link the issue:
Closes #42. - CI green before merge.
- One approval required, routed by
CODEOWNERS. - Squash-merge; the branch is deleted on merge. Full commit-by-commit detail and the review thread stay preserved in the PR.
- For genuine pair work, add
Co-authored-by:trailers so everyone gets credit.
CI green Β· reviewed and approved Β· issue linked Β· docs updated if behavior changed.

Datasets and trained models are never committed β the training scripts
download their sources and .gitignore keeps artifacts out of the repo. See
docs/ for environment and run steps.
